Beyond Three Dimensions: A Journey into 4D Spacetime

Our tangible world is firmly rooted in three dimensions: length, width, and height. But, the universe may extend far beyond this familiar framework, housing a fourth dimension known as time. This concept of four-dimensional spacetime, originally theorized by Albert Einstein, revolutionized our understanding of gravity and the cosmos.
